Welcome Guest, Not a member yet? Register   Sign In
Cannot modify header information
#1

[eluser]Unknown[/eluser]
Warnaing:
Code:
A PHP Error was encountered

Severity: Notice

Message: Undefined property: stdClass::$user_id

Filename: models/login_model.php

Line Number: 18
A PHP Error was encountered

Severity: Warning

Message: Cannot modify header information - headers already sent by (output started at /home3/banglacu/public_html/admin/system/libraries/Exceptions.php:166)

Filename: libraries/Session.php

Line Number: 662

controller:

Code:
<?php
class Users extends Controller {
function Users()
  {
   parent::Controller();
  }  
function index()
  {
   $this->login();
  }
        function dashboard()
                {
                    
                }
function login()
  {
         $this->form_validation->set_rules('username','username', 'required|trim|max_langth[50]|xss_clean');
         $this->form_validation->set_rules('password','password', 'required|trim|max_langth[50]|xss_clean');
         if ($this->form_validation->run()== FALSE)
          {
            $this->load->view('login_page');
          }
        else
         {
         $username=$this->input->post('username',TRUE);
         $password=$this->input->post('password',TRUE);
         //$this->load->Model('Login_model');
          $user_id = $this->Login_model->check_login($username,$password);          
            
             if(!$user_id)
                  {
                  $this->session->set_flashdata('login_error',TRUE);
                        
                  }
                 else
                 {
                
                 $this->session->set_userdata(array('logged_in'=> TRUE,'user_id' => $user_id  ));
                 }
   }
}
}?>

[color=green]Model:[/color]

<?php class Login_model extends Model {

  function Login_model()
   {
  
    parent:: Model();
    }
  
  function check_login($username,$password)
   {
      $user = xss_clean($username);
      //$pass = sha1($password);
      
      $qry="SELECT * FROM user WHERE username=? AND password=?";
      $res=$this->db->query($qry,array($user,$password));
      if($res->num_rows()>0)
      {
        return $res->row(0)->user_id;
        
      }
      else
      {
       return FALSE;
      }
   }



}




Theme © iAndrew 2016 - Forum software by © MyBB